Degree of Renal Dysfunction in Patients of Subclinical and Overt Hypothyroidism

Journal Title: Journal of Medical Science And clinical Research - Year 2017, Vol 5, Issue 1

Abstract

Background: Thyroid hormones deficiency may lead to impaired renal function either directly or indirectly. Impaired renal function is characterized by increased serum creatinine and decreased creatinine clearance. This study was intended to evaluate the level of serum creatinine and creatinine clearance in both subclinical and overt hypothyroid patients. Materials and Methods: 104 hypothyroid patients were divided in two equal groups namely subclinical and overt hypothyroids based on their serum TSH levels. 52 age, sex and weight matched euthyroid controls were used for comparison. Result: Significantly raised serum creatinine was found in overt hypothyroids as compared to both subclinical hypothyroids and controls. Creatinine clearance was found significantly low in overt hypothyroids as compared to controls. Conclusion: Decrease in creatinine clearance was found more profound as compared to increase in serum creatinine in hypothyroids. Thus creatinine clearance is better early marker for renal dysfunction in hypothyroids.
